Han Chen has emerged among the new generation of concert pianists as a uniquely fearless performer in a wide variety of musical settings. Gold Medalist at the 2013 China International Piano Competition and a prizewinner at the 2018 Honens International Piano Competition, he has been praised by Gramophone as “impressively commanding and authoritative” and further cited by The New York Times for his “graceful touch,” “rhythmic precision,” and “hypnotic charm,” Chen’s virtuosity is enriched by a probing commitment to new works as well as the great cornerstones of the piano repertory. This vision is clearly evident in his four solo Naxos CDs focusing on Franz Liszt, Anton Rubinstein, Thomas Adès, and György Ligeti. As soloist with orchestra, Chen’s appearances include the Calgary Philharmonic, Fort Worth Symphony, Riverside Symphony, Hong Kong Philharmonic, National Taiwan Symphony, and Xiamen Philharmonic. In addition, he has performed as recitalist throughout Europe, North America, and China.
